How to Safeguard Against Future Data Breaches
Implement Multi-Layered Security Protocols
Organizations must strengthen their digital fortresses by adopting multi-layered security systems. These can include firewalls, intrusion detection systems, and endpoint protection tools. Regular security audits also help identify vulnerabilities before they are exploited.
Educate Employees on Cyber Hygiene Practices
Human error remains the leading cause of data breaches. Companies should regularly train employees on secure password practices, phishing detection, and the importance of reporting suspicious activities. A well-informed workforce can be a powerful first line of defense.
Employ Real-Time Threat Monitoring Tools
Using AI-driven monitoring tools can help detect unusual activities as they happen. Real-time alerts enable security teams to respond before minor breaches escalate into full-scale leaks. Speed is critical in minimizing damage from unauthorized data access.
